The problem statement
I want to share a common data state between vanilla js and react app.
What is in this POC
- We will create two similar counter apps in vanilla and react.
- The count should be stored in a common state
- If we update the count in vanilla, it should be reflected in react and vice-verse

How does it work
- Create a basic vanilla js website using redux store.
- Expose the created store to
window
element.
const store = createStore(reducer);
window.customStore = store
- Make use of
store.dispatch
function in react to fire a store action.
<button onClick={() => store.dispatch({type: 'INCREMENT'})}>
- Listen to changes in store using
store.subscribe
store.subscribe(() => {
setCount(store.getState().counter)
})
